23.11 (To start with) the parts of the dead body which are washed in ablution

٢٣۔١١ باب مَوَاضِعِ الْوُضُوءِ مِنَ الْمَيِّتِ

bukhari:1256Yaḥyá b. Mūsá > Wakīʿ > Sufyān > Khālid al-Ḥadhhāʾ > Ḥafṣah b. Sīrīn > Um ʿAṭiyyah

When we washed the deceased daughter of the Prophet, he said to us, while we were washing her, "Start the bath from the right side and from the parts which are washed in ablution."
